sql经典查询语句

select * from table1 where 工资>2500 and 工资<3000 //同上

select 姓名 from table1 where 性别='0' and 工资='4000'

select * from table1 where not 工资= 3200

select * from table1 order by 工资desc //将工资按照降序排列

select * from table1 order by 工资 asc //将工资按照升序排列

select * from table1 where year(出身日期)=1987 //查询table1 中所有出身在1987的人select * from table1 where name like '%张' /'%张%' /'张%' //查询1,首位字‘张’3,尾位字‘张’2,模糊查询

select * from table1 order by money desc //查询表1按照工资的降序排列表1 (升序为asc)

select * from table1 where brithday is null //查询表1 中出身日期为空的人

use 数据库(aa) //使用数据库aa

create bb(数据库) //创建数据库bb

create table table3 ( name varchar(10),sex varchar(2),money money, brithday datetime)//创建一个表3中有姓名,性别,工资,出身日期 (此表说明有四列)

insert into table3 values ('张三','男','2500','1989-1-5')//在表中添加一行张三的记录

alter table table3 add tilte varchar(10) //向表3 中添加一列“title(职位)”

alter table table3 drop column sex //删除table3中‘性别’这一列

drop database aa //删除数据库aa

drop table table3 //删除表3

delete * from table3 //删除table3 中所有的数据,但table3这个表还在

delete from table1 where 姓名='倪涛' and 日期 is null

delete from table1 where 姓名='倪涛' and 日期='1971'

select * into table2 from table3 //将表3中的所有数据转换成表2 (相当于复制)

update table3 set money=money*1.2 //为表3所有人工资都增长20%

update table3 set money=money*1.2 where title='经理' //为表3中“职位”是经理的人工资增长20%

update table1 set 工资= 5000 where 姓名='孙八' //将姓名为孙八的人的工资改为5000

update table1 set 姓名='敬光' where 姓名='倪涛' and 性别=1 //将性别为男和姓名为倪涛的人改为敬光

(0)

相关推荐

  • SQL SELECT 查询语句

    SELECT 语句用于从表中选取数据.SELECT查询语句也是最常使用的,使用形式也最丰富,查询的结果会被存储在一个结果表中(称为结果集) 操作方法 01 语法一:查询表的指定列 SELECT 列名称 ...

  • SQL server数据库查询语句使用方法详细讲解

    一、 简单查询 简单的Transact-SQL查询只包括选择列表、FROM子句和WHERE子句。它们分别说明所查询列、查询的表或视图、以及搜索条件等。 例如,下面的语句查询testtable表中姓名为 ...

  • 预防查询语句数据库注入漏洞攻击

    简单地说,Sql注入就是将Sql代码传递到应用程序的过程,但不是按照应用程序开发人员预定或期望的方式插入,相当大一部分程序员在编写代码的时候,并没有对用户输入数据的合法性进行判断,使应用程序存在安全隐 ...

  • SQL怎么查询每个数据库的标识ID号

    SQL SERVER每个数据库都对应一个唯一的数据库DB_ID标识ID,有时候有不只需要数据名,还需要使用到数据的DB_ID标识ID,怎么使用的select查询出数据库的标识ID呢,请参考下面具体操作 ...

  • SQL 的查询结果以Excel的方式导出

    SQL 查询的结果是以表格的形式显示的,但是我们如何将其做成真正的Excel表格呢?下面简单的介绍几种导出SQL查询结果的方法! 操作方法 01 打开 SQL server企业管理器 02 新建查询, ...

  • SQL查询:[1]SQL基础查询

    SQL查询语句用来检索数据库数据.查询是通过执行SELECT来完成的.在所有SQL语句中,SELECT语句是最为灵活复杂. 基础知识 01 查询语句基本语法如下: SELECT <*,colum ...

  • MySql查询语句介绍,多表联合查询

    mysql在网站开发中,越来越多人使用了,方便部署,方便使用.我们要掌握mysql,首先要学习查询语句.查询单个表的数据,和多个表的联合查询. 上一篇写了[MySql查询语句介绍,单表查询],下面以一 ...

  • MySql查询语句介绍,单表查询

    mysql在网站开发中,越来越多人使用了,方便部署,方便使用.我们要掌握mysql,首先要学习查询语句.查询单个表的数据,和多个表的联合查询. 下面以一些例子来先简单介绍下单表查询. 操作方法 01 ...

  • sql软件查询所有科目都不及格的同学的方法

    sql软件中是一款可以用来查询数据的软件,下面给大家讲讲sql软件查询所有科目都不及格的同学的方法.具体如下:1. 第一步,在电脑上打开sql软件,然后找到数据库并右击选择新建查询.2.第二步,输入如 ...